Wien River Cycle Path – Paul-Amann Bridge loop from Johnstraße

01:37

30.6km

370m

Road cycling

Moderate road ride. Good fitness required. Some segments of this route may be unpaved and difficult to ride.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.

Paul-Amann Bridge

Highlight • Bridge

The bridge was built in 2010 based on a design by Rudolf Brandstötter. It was named after the writer and translator Paul Amann (1884 - 1958), who was able to flee Nazi persecution.
